Georgia police have released dramatic body camera footage of a woman being rescued from a burning car. Due to the quick actions of the sergeant, a life was potentially saved.
On July 1, Sergeant Ashleigh Taylor of the Candler County Sheriff’s Department was called to respond to a vehicle crash on Highway 46. Sgt. Taylor arrived at the scene to find that the vehicle had driven off the road, into the woods and was on fire.

After approaching the vehicle and shouting to get the attention of the driver, Sgt. Taylor smashed a front window with his baton and managed to haul the driver from her seat as flames grew along the underside of the car. In the meantime, a number of passing motorists, seeing the commotion, stopped by the side of the road to assist….
